1*4882a593SmuzhiyunWhat: /sys/module/xen_blkfront/parameters/max_indirect_segments 2*4882a593SmuzhiyunDate: June 2013 3*4882a593SmuzhiyunKernelVersion: 3.11 4*4882a593SmuzhiyunContact: Konrad Rzeszutek Wilk <konrad.wilk@oracle.com> 5*4882a593SmuzhiyunDescription: 6*4882a593Smuzhiyun Maximum number of segments that the frontend will negotiate 7*4882a593Smuzhiyun with the backend for indirect descriptors. The default value 8*4882a593Smuzhiyun is 32 - higher value means more potential throughput but more 9*4882a593Smuzhiyun memory usage. The backend picks the minimum of the frontend 10*4882a593Smuzhiyun and its default backend value. 11*4882a593Smuzhiyun 12*4882a593SmuzhiyunWhat: /sys/module/xen_blkfront/parameters/feature_persistent 13*4882a593SmuzhiyunDate: September 2020 14*4882a593SmuzhiyunKernelVersion: 5.10 15*4882a593SmuzhiyunContact: SeongJae Park <sjpark@amazon.de> 16*4882a593SmuzhiyunDescription: 17*4882a593Smuzhiyun Whether to enable the persistent grants feature or not. Note 18*4882a593Smuzhiyun that this option only takes effect on newly connected frontends. 19*4882a593Smuzhiyun The default is Y (enable). 20
